We purchased this bike for our son who just learned to ride a bike this summer. We decided on the Freestyle 5 because of the front and back hand brakes versus the pedal brakes most kids bikes offer. He has an older brother who has a mountain bike that changes gears and can pedal backwards. This was a good compromise to getting him a bike that fit him without needing the different gears at his age. About 2 months into riding his bike the chain started falling off every single time he rode it. I tried everything I could think of and even things YouTube suggested with getting the tension correct. It didn’t change anything, the chain kept coming off. It really seemed like the bearings had dirt or sand in them and it was in an enclosed casing that I couldn’t access with the tools I have. My son was disappointed, sad, and mad because even if he rode his bike for a few minutes to play with friends he was left behind when his chain would inevitably come off. I decided as a last ditch effort to reach out to RoyalBaby and find out if they had parts I could purchase to get him back on his bike. After a few weeks and several emails back and forth RoyalBaby sent us a whole new bike! I was flabbergasted! We could not be more happy with how the customer service department has helped us with this issue. We are beyond grateful and I don’t want to sound like we are not but I just want to mention we were sent the Freestyle 3 which has a different braking system than that of the Freestyle 5. The 3 has the coasting pedal brakes you push back to stop with and the 5 has the front and back hand brakes. Depending on your child and what they prefer to do when they brake while biking is what bike I would suggest to purchase. They look almost identical besides the way you stop. I’m so mad that I bought this. I got it for my 3yo daughter who has mastered her little balance bike and wants to learn how to ride with pedals. Set up: Firstly, the set up is NOT easy. You have to watch the videos and if the brakes don’t come set up perfectly already, good luck. It took me an hour to figure out how to adjust the front brakes and I almost stripped one of the nuts using the tool they send you in the process. There are no instructions for where to put the reflectors, one is missing a screw. Fit and weight: my daughter can’t ride it by herself because the seat is too high even in the lowest position (she’s 3.5, we got a 14inch—her brother’s 16in bike from another brand has a lower seat height). It’s also too heavy for her to manage on her own—she can’t even walk it up the driveway by herself. Build: besides the crappy screws and finicky brakes, the seat handle for parents to help kids balance is so lightweight and flimsy compared to the weight of the bike, so it feels like it’s going to snap if the bike tilts. Overall I’m so upset. I wish I would have saved the money and waited for a better bike, even if it cost twice as much as this used. Did not meet my needs at all.
